Personally, it's difficult to see a folder being a primary option for self-defense using an edged weapon. Yes, they'll work, but why choose a more complicated item for sticky situations, when you could use a fixed blade? Folders have more moving parts, so naturally, there are more possible points of failure. I am very interested in that pikall (or however you spell it) by Steel City Cutlery.
